Jimmy Mahon (Gleeson) is a soldier for the Irish rebellion.
Hes a socialist, a feminist, and a member of the Irish Citizen Army.
This was a group of trade union volunteers who believed in both Irish independence and workers rights.
Through the character of Jimmy,Rebelliondepicts that there were different factions within the movement for independence.
Jimmys mentor is James Connolly (Brian McCardie).
